Maruti Suzuki opens Rs 35,000-crore Kharkhoda mega plant in Haryana

Maruti Suzuki inaugurated its 800-acre Kharkhoda facility with an initial capacity of 500,000 vehicles annually, scaling to 1 million units. The plant supports a 4-million-unit yearly target, strengthens exports to ~100 countries and creates 21,000 jobs.
